10 B.2.5 DEFINITIONS Roofing Terminology: Refer to ASTM D 1079 and glossary in NRCA's "The NRCA Roofing Manual" for definition of terms related to roofing work in this Section Existing Roofing System: Built-up asphalt roofing, and components and accessories between deck and roofing membrane Roofing Re-Coating Preparation: Existing roofing that is to remain and be prepared to accept restorative coating application Patching: Removal of a portion of existing membrane roofing system from deck or removal of selected components and accessories from existing membrane roofing system and replacement with similar materials Remove: Detach items from existing construction and legally dispose of them off-site unless indicated to be removed and reinstalled Existing to Remain: Existing items of construction that are not indicated to be removed. B.2.9 PROJECT CONDITIONS Weather Limitations: Proceed with rehabilitation work only when existing and forecasted weather conditions permit Work to proceed without water entering into existing roofing system or building Store all materials prior to application at temperatures between 60 and 90 deg. F Apply coatings within range of ambient and substrate temperatures recommended by manufacturer. Do not apply materials when air temperature is below 50 or above 110 deg. F Do not apply roofing in snow, rain, fog, or mist Protect building to be rehabilitated, adjacent buildings, walkways, site improvements, exterior plantings, and landscaping from damage or soiling from rehabilitation operations Maintain access to existing walkways, corridors, and other adjacent occupied or used facilities Daily Protection: Coordinate installation of roofing so insulation and other components of roofing system not permanently exposed are not subjected to precipitation or left uncovered at the end of the workday or when rain is forecast Owner will occupy portions of building immediately below re-coating area. Conduct re-coating so Owner's operations will not be disrupted. Provide Owner with not less than 72 hours' notice of activities that may affect Owner's operations. B.2.13 PERFORMANCE REQUIREMENTS General Performance: Rehabilitated roofing shall withstand exposure to weather without failure or leaks due to defective manufacture or installation Accelerated Weathering: Roofing system shall withstand 2000 hours of exposure when tested according to ASTM G 152, ASTM G 154, or ASTM G Material Compatibility: Provide roofing materials that are compatible with one another under conditions of service and application required, as demonstrated by roofing manufacturer based on testing and field experience Exterior Fire-Test Exposure: CAN/ULC S107, Class A; for application and roof slopes indicated, as determined by testing identical membrane roofing materials by a qualified testing agency. Materials shall be identified with appropriate markings of applicable testing agency. B.2.14 MATERIALS, GENERAL General: Re-coating materials recommended by roofing system manufacturer for intended use and compatible with components of existing membrane roofing system Temporary Roofing Materials: Selection of materials and design of temporary roofing is responsibility of Contractor Infill Materials: Where required to replace test cores and to patch existing roofing, use infill materials matching existing membrane roofing system materials, unless otherwise indicated. 13

14 B.2.15 RESTORATIVE COATINGS AND TOP COATINGS Rubberized Asphalt Emulsion: One-part, non-fibrated, cold-applied, rubberized asphalt emulsion formulated for compatibility and use with specified roofing membranes and flashings Basis of design product: Tremco, TremLastic SP Volatile Organic Compounds (VOC), maximum, ASTM D 3960: Less than 50 g/l Tensile Strength at 77 deg. F (25 deg. C), minimum, ASTM D 412: 150 psi (1000 kpa) Elongation at 77 deg. F (25 deg. C), minimum, ASTM D 412: 100 percent. B.2.16 FLASHING MATERIALS Elastomeric Flashing Sheet: Elastomeric, polyester-reinforced sheet with EPDM and SBR thermoset elastomers Basis of design product: Tremco, TRA Elastomeric Sheeting Breaking Strength, minimum, ASTM D 751: machine direction 350 lbf (1550 N); cross machine direction 300 lbf (1330 N) Tear Strength, minimum, ASTM D 751: machine direction 77 lbf (342 N); cross machine direction 77 lbf (342 N) Elongation at Failure: ASTM D 751: 30 percent minimum Temperature Flexibility, minimum, ASTM D 2136: -40 deg. F (- 50 deg. C) Thickness, minimum, ASTM D 751: inch (1.1 mm) Elastomeric Flashing Adhesive, Butyl Rubber-Based: One-part, coldapplied, elastomeric trowel-grade adhesive specially formulated for compatibility and use with specified roofing membranes and flashings Basis of design product: Tremco, Sheeting Bond Volatile Organic Compounds (VOC), maximum, ASTM D 3960: 250 g/l Adhesion in Peel, minimum, ASTM D 1876: 3 lbf/in (0.5 N/mm) Lap Shear Adhesion, minimum, ASTM D 816: 18 psi (124 kpa). B.2.17 AUXILIARY MATERIALS General: Auxiliary materials recommended by roofing system manufacturer for intended use and compatible with existing roofing system Polyester Reinforcing Fabric: 100 percent stitch-bonded mildew-resistant polyester fabric intended for reinforcement of compatible fluid-applied membranes and flashings Basis of Design Product: Tremco, Permafab. Or approved Burmesh Tensile Strength, ASTM D 1682: Not less than 50 lbf. (222 N) Elongation, ASTM D 1682: Not less than 60 percent Tear Strength, ASTM D 1117: Not less than 16 lbf. (70 N) Weight: 3 oz. /sq. yd. (102 g/sq. m). 14

15 Elastomeric Roofing Mastic, Low-Volatile: One-part, trowelgrade, elastomeric roof mastic specially formulated for compatibility and use with specified roofing membranes and flashings Basis of design product: Tremco, POLYroof LV Volatile Organic Compounds (VOC), maximum, ASTM D 3960: 300 g/l Elongation at 77 deg. F (25 deg. C), minimum, ASTM D 412: 1000 percent Recovery from 500 percent Elongation, minimum, ASTM D 412: 500 percent Flexibility at -40 deg. F (-40 deg. C), ASTM D 3111: No cracking Roofing Mastic, Asphalt: ASTM D 4586, Type II, Class 1, onepart, cold-applied mastic specially formulated for compatibility and use with specified roofing membranes and flashings Basis of design product: Tremco, EcoMastic Volatile Organic Compounds (VOC), maximum, ASTM D 6511: 234 g/l Resistance to Sag, maximum, ASTM D 4586: 1/8 inch (3.1 mm) Moisture Vapor Transmission, ASTM E 398: 0.25 g/100 sq. in. /24 hr at in. thickness, average Elastomeric Pitch Pocket Sealer: Solvent-free, low-odor, twocomponent, fast setting urethane sealant, ASTM C920, Type M, Grade P, Class 12.5, Use O, specially formulated for compatibility and use with specified roofing membranes and flashings Basis of design product: Tremco, TremSEAL Pitch Pocket Sealer Volatile Organic Compounds (VOC), maximum, ASTM D 3960: 0 g/l Hardness, ASTM C 661: Shore A Metal Flashing Sheet: Provide metal flashing sheet matching type, thickness, finish, and profile of existing metal flashing and trim Stone Aggregate Surfacing: Regular pea stone gravel. B.2.18 WALKWAYS Walkway Roof Pavers: Heavyweight, hydraulically pressed, concrete units, with top edges beveled 3/16 inch (5 mm), factory cast for use as roof pavers; absorption not greater than 5 percent, ASTM C 140; no breakage and maximum 1 percent mass loss when tested for freeze-thaw resistance, ASTM C Size: 24 by 24 inches (600 by 600 mm) Weight: 18 lb/sq. ft. (90 kg/sq. m.), minimum Compressive Strength: 6500 psi (45 MPa), minimum Colors and Textures: As selected from manufacturer's full range. 15

16 B.2.19 EXECUTION B.2.20 PREPARATION Protect existing roofing system that is indicated not to be rehabilitated, and adjacent portions of building and building equipment Mask surfaces to be protected. Seal joints subject to infiltration by coating materials Limit traffic and material storage to areas of existing roofing membrane that have been protected Maintain temporary protection and leave in place until replacement roofing has been completed Shut down air intake equipment in the vicinity of the Work in coordination with the Owner. Cover air intake louvers before proceeding with re-coating work that could affect indoor air quality or activate smoke detectors in the ductwork Verify that rooftop utilities and service piping affected by the Work have been shut off before commencing Work Maintain roof drains in functioning condition to ensure roof drainage at end of each workday. Prevent debris from entering or blocking roof drains and conductors. Use roof-drain plugs specifically designed for this purpose. Remove roof-drain plugs at end of each workday, when no work is taking place, or when rain is forecast Do not permit water to enter into or under existing membrane roofing system components that are to remain. B.2.21 ROOFING COATING PREPARATION Roofing Patching and Partial Tear-off: Replace areas of wet and damaged insulation with materials matching the characteristics of the existing Existing Flashing and Detail Preparation: Repair flashings, gravel stops, copings, and other roof-related sheet metal and trim elements. Reseal joints, replace loose or missing fasteners, and replace components where required to leave in a watertight condition Do not damage metal counterflashings that are to remain. Replace metal counterflashings damaged during removal with counterflashings of same metal, weight or thickness, and finish Roof Drains: Install new drain insert complete with U-flow Membrane Surface Preparation: Remove aggregate ballast from roofing membrane Remove pavers from roofing membrane. Store and protect pavers for reuse. Discard cracked pavers and replace with new. 16

17 Remove blisters, ridges, buckles, and other substrate irregularities from existing roofing membrane that would inhibit application of uniform, waterproof coating Repair membrane at locations where irregularities have been removed Broom clean existing substrate Verify that existing substrate is dry before proceeding with application of coating. Spot check substrates with an electrical capacitance moisturedetection meter Verify adhesion of new products. B.2.22 REPLACEMENT FLASHING AND STRIPPING INSTALLATION Install replacement flashings on all perimeters unless indicated on the drawings. Install on all sloping and vertical surfaces, at roof edges, and at penetrations through roof, and secure to substrates according to roofing system manufacturer's written instructions and as follows: Elastomeric Flashing-Sheet Stripping: Install elastomeric flashing-sheet in a continuous bed of cold-applied adhesive and extend onto roofing membrane Flashing to be adhered at a rate of 15 gallons per square ft Flashing is to be back nailed 8inches o.c Spud gravel at base of flashings to allow for proper adhesion of new flashings Strip in leading edge a minimum of 6inches onto the field of the roof with 3 coursings of mastic and mesh Reinforce all seams with 3 coursing of rubberized mastic and mesh. B.2.23 ROOF COATING APPLICATION Restorative Flood Coat: Promptly after preparing membrane substrate and base flashings and stripping, flood-coat roof surface with 7 gal./100 sq. ft. of restorative coating Aggregate Surfacing: While flood coat is fluid, cast the following average weight of aggregate in a uniform course: Aggregate Weight: lb/100 sq. ft Aluminized Coating: apply coating to all exposed membrane flashings and asphalt based mastics. B.2.24 WALKWAY INSTALLATION Reinstall walkways following application of coating. Locate as originally indicated, or as directed by Owner. Replace damaged pads with new.
